We are looking for a detail oriented and hands on Quality Auditor to help ensure the products we deliver meet both our internal standards and our customers’ expectations.
In this role, you will play a key part in maintaining product quality on the production floor by conducting audits, verifying inspection processes, and working closely with our Quality Engineering team to identify and resolve issues. If you enjoy problem solving, thrive in a fast paced environment, and take pride in doing things right the first time, this could be a great fit for you.
WhatYou Will Do
- Perform in process and final audits to ensure products meet quality standards
- Review and make final disposition decisions on acceptable and non conforming parts
- Provide real time feedback to production teams on quality questions
- Identify and address quality gaps in inspection tools, setups, and standards
- Verify inspection stations meet setup requirements such as lighting, tools, and distance
- Assist with maintaining and updating standard books and inspection documentation
- Support continuous improvement efforts by identifying opportunities and suggesting solutions
- Create and maintain product retain files
- Ensure compliance with safety and environmental procedures
- Stop production and escalate issues when quality concerns arise
